📅 March Madness – NCAA Tournament 2026 Full Schedule
The tournament begins with the First Four on March 17–18 and concludes with the National Championship on April 6, 2026. Here’s a structured breakdown of key rounds:
📅 First Four – March 17–18
| Date | Game | Time (ET) | TV / Live Stream |
|---|---|---|---|
| Mar 17 | No. 16 UMBC vs. No. 16 Howard | 6:40 PM | truTV, DIRECTV |
| Mar 17 | No. 11 Texas vs. No. 11 NC State | 9:15 PM | truTV, DIRECTV |
| Mar 18 | No. 16 Prairie View A&M vs. No. 16 Lehigh | 6:40 PM | truTV, DIRECTV |
| Mar 18 | No. 11 Miami (Ohio) vs. No. 11 SMU | 9:15 PM | truTV, DIRECTV |
🔥 Round 1 – March 19
| Game | Time (ET) | TV / Live Stream |
|---|---|---|
| Ohio State vs. TCU | 12:15 PM | CBS, Fubo, Paramount+ |
| Nebraska vs. Troy | 12:40 PM | truTV, DIRECTV |
| Louisville vs. South Florida | 1:30 PM | TNT, DIRECTV |
| Wisconsin vs. High Point | 1:50 PM | TBS, DIRECTV |
| Duke vs. Siena | 2:50 PM | CBS, Fubo, Paramount+ |
| Vanderbilt vs. McNeese | 3:15 PM | truTV, DIRECTV |
| Michigan State vs. North Dakota State | 4:05 PM | TNT, DIRECTV |
| Arkansas vs. Hawaii | 4:25 PM | TBS, DIRECTV |
| North Carolina vs. VCU | 6:50 PM | TNT, DIRECTV |
| Michigan vs. UMBC/Howard | 7:10 PM | CBS, Fubo, Paramount+ |
| BYU vs. Texas/NC State | 7:25 PM | TBS, DIRECTV |
| Saint Mary’s vs. Texas A&M | 7:35 PM | truTV, DIRECTV |
| Illinois vs. Penn | 9:25 PM | TNT, DIRECTV |
| Georgia vs. Saint Louis | 9:45 PM | CBS, Fubo, Paramount+ |
| Gonzaga vs. Kennesaw State | 10:00 PM | TBS, DIRECTV |
| Houston vs. Idaho | 10:10 PM | truTV, DIRECTV |
⚡ Round 1 – March 20
| Game | Time (ET) | TV / Live Stream |
|---|---|---|
| Kentucky vs. Santa Clara | 12:15 PM | CBS, Fubo, Paramount+ |
| Texas Tech vs. Akron | 12:40 PM | truTV, DIRECTV |
| Arizona vs. LIU | 1:35 PM | TNT, DIRECTV |
| Virginia vs. Wright State | 1:50 PM | TBS, DIRECTV |
| Iowa State vs. Tennessee State | 2:50 PM | CBS, Fubo, Paramount+ |
| Alabama vs. Hofstra | 3:15 PM | truTV, DIRECTV |
| Villanova vs. Utah State | 4:10 PM | TNT, DIRECTV |
| Tennessee vs. Miami (Ohio)/SMU | 4:25 PM | TBS, DIRECTV |
| Clemson vs. Iowa | 6:50 PM | TNT, DIRECTV |
| St. John’s vs. Northern Iowa | 7:10 PM | CBS, Fubo, Paramount+ |
| UCLA vs. UCF | 7:25 PM | TBS, DIRECTV |
| Purdue vs. Queens | 7:35 PM | truTV, DIRECTV |
| Florida vs. Prairie View A&M/Lehigh | 9:25 PM | TNT, DIRECTV |
| Kansas vs. Cal Baptist | 9:45 PM | CBS, Fubo, Paramount+ |
| UConn vs. Furman | 10:00 PM | TBS, DIRECTV |
| Miami (Fla.) vs. Missouri | 10:10 PM | truTV, DIRECTV |

📊 Tournament Broadcast Overview
| Round | TV Channels | Live Streaming |
|---|---|---|
| First Four | truTV | DIRECTV |
| First Round | CBS, TBS, TNT, truTV | DIRECTV, Fubo, Paramount+ |
| Second Round | CBS, TBS, TNT, truTV | DIRECTV, Fubo, Paramount+ |
| Sweet 16 | CBS, TBS, truTV | DIRECTV, Fubo, Paramount+ |
| Elite Eight | CBS, TBS, truTV | DIRECTV, Fubo, Paramount+ |
| Final Four | TBS, truTV | DIRECTV |
| Championship | TBS, truTV | DIRECTV |
